Common Challenges in B2B Wholesale Export
While exporting can be lucrative, it comes with its unique set of challenges. This article outlines common obstacles B2B wholesale suppliers face and offers practical solutions.
1. Regulatory Compliance
Navigating export regulations can be challenging. Stay informed by collaborating with compliance experts who can guide you through the necessary documentation and legal requirements.
2. Currency Fluctuations
Currency volatility can impact profit margins. Consider hedging strategies or pricing contracts in stable currencies to mitigate risks associated with exchange rate fluctuations.
3. Logistics and Delivery Issues
Late deliveries can affect customer satisfaction. Partner with reliable logistics companies and establish a robust supply chain management process to ensure timely deliveries.
4. Communication Barriers
Language differences can lead to misunderstandings. Employ multilingual staff or utilize translation services to facilitate clear communication with international clients.
5. Market Competition
The global market is competitive. Focus on differentiating your products and services through quality and innovation to stand out against competitors.
